Drag, Spirituality, and Identity: A Chat with Polly Amber Ross and Peter Pansexual

There's a wide variance in the human race. So if you don't already know that, I encourage you to look into that. And I think that, like discussing the idea of like, it's a major sacrifice to leave the community that you're raised in, and so finding queer community and finding drag are so important in those ways.
Ever thought about how drag, spirituality, and queerness intersect? Bonnie Violet, a queer chaplain, brings together Polly Amber Ross and Peter Pansexual for a riveting conversation on these very topics. Polly Amber Ross, an undead housewife alter ego of Chris Steele, uses drag to dissect the patriarchy in a subversive and theatrical manner. Meanwhile, Peter Pansexual, another alter ego, is on a journey to unlearn toxic masculinity while embracing his trans non-binary identity.
Together, they offer a unique blend of chaos magic, political activism, and personal stories that are both enlightening and entertaining. Bonnie Violet guides this engaging dialogue, exploring how drag can be a powerful tool for understanding one's gender identity and spiritual self. Polly shares how drag has been instrumental in her journey of self-discovery and acceptance. Peter adds his perspective on the challenges of breaking free from toxic masculinity and how spirituality plays a role in his transformation.
The episode doesn't shy away from heavy topics like college trauma and the struggle to find community amidst negative religious messaging. Yet, it remains uplifting, showcasing the resilience and creativity that come from embracing one's true self. Bonnie sums it up well: 'There's a wide variance in the human race', highlighting the beauty in our differences.
